I just recently got a used Valence, and my laptop wallwart gets REAL hot when charging too.  I actually blew another charger I had when I first tryed to charge the batt.  I didn't realize that the Valence wants to pull like 3amps from the charger, the one I was using was rated 500ma :-[ oops.  Thats prolly why the laptop wallwart gets so hot.  If your's is reated at less than 3amps, it may be working real hard.  Mine is rated at 2.7, so it's close enough (I hope).  I def won't charge mine when I'm not home...
